Output dfc26b53ed5ba9e38b8ba8eebdd983df3d3dc6db46313d3f9f0f6cdb23fd2539:0

value
6976369858388
script pubkey
OP_0 OP_PUSHBYTES_20 8d43a079d222477803bc0f50c39ce7587b030075
address
tb1q34p6q7wjyfrhsqaupagv8888tpasxqr4kjzz2u
transaction
dfc26b53ed5ba9e38b8ba8eebdd983df3d3dc6db46313d3f9f0f6cdb23fd2539
confirmations
171829
spent
true